Introduction to Steel Edging

Steel edging is a traditional and widely used material for landscape edging. It is known for its durability and ability to withstand harsh weather conditions. Steel edging comes in various forms, including rolled steel, steel strips, and steel plates, offering flexibility in design and application. The primary advantage of steel edging is its cost-effectiveness, as it is generally less expensive than aluminum and can provide a long-lasting barrier with proper maintenance.

Advantages of Steel Edging

Steel edging offers several advantages that make it a preferred choice for many landscapers and homeowners:
– It is highly durable and can last for many years without significant degradation.
– Steel edging is versatile and can be used in a variety of settings, from residential gardens to commercial landscapes.
– It provides a clean and defined look to the landscape, making it ideal for creating distinct borders and patterns.

Disadvantages of Steel Edging

Despite its benefits, steel edging also has some drawbacks:
– It can rust over time, especially when exposed to moisture, which can compromise its integrity and appearance.
– Steel edging may require additional coating or painting to protect it from corrosion, adding to its overall cost.
– The installation of steel edging can be more labor-intensive compared to aluminum, as it often requires digging and setting the edging material into the ground.

Introduction to Aluminum Edging

Aluminum edging has gained popularity in recent years due to its lightweight, corrosion-resistant, and environmentally friendly properties. Unlike steel, aluminum does not rust, making it an excellent choice for areas with high moisture levels or where maintenance is minimal. Aluminum edging is available in various styles, including decorative edges and flexible strips, offering a range of design possibilities.

Advantages of Aluminum Edging

Aluminum edging boasts several advantages that make it an attractive option for landscaping:
– It is resistant to corrosion, eliminating the need for additional protective coatings and reducing maintenance costs.
– Aluminum edging is lightweight and easy to install, making it a favorite among DIY enthusiasts and professional landscapers alike.
– It is eco-friendly, as aluminum is recyclable and can be reused, reducing waste and the demand for new raw materials.

Disadvantages of Aluminum Edging

While aluminum edging has its perks, it also comes with some disadvantages:
– Aluminum is generally more expensive than steel, which can be a deterrent for those on a tight budget.
– It may not be as durable as steel in terms of withstanding heavy impacts or extreme weather conditions.
– The flexibility of aluminum edging, while beneficial for curved designs, can also make it more prone to bending or deformation under certain conditions.

What are the primary differences between steel and aluminum edging in terms of durability and maintenance?

Steel edging and aluminum edging have distinct differences when it comes to durability and maintenance. Steel edging is known for its strength and ability to withstand harsh weather conditions, heavy foot traffic, and extreme temperatures. It is less likely to bend or warp, making it a great option for high-traffic areas or regions with extreme weather conditions. On the other hand, aluminum edging is more prone to bending and warping, especially when exposed to heavy loads or extreme temperatures.

However, aluminum edging requires less maintenance compared to steel edging. Aluminum is resistant to corrosion and does not rust, which means it does not need to be coated or painted to protect it from the elements. In contrast, steel edging may require periodic coating or painting to prevent rust and corrosion. Additionally, aluminum edging is generally easier to clean and maintain, as it can be simply hosed down with water to remove dirt and debris. Overall, the choice between steel and aluminum edging ultimately depends on the specific needs and conditions of the landscape, as well as the desired level of maintenance and upkeep.

Are there any safety considerations to take into account when installing and using steel and aluminum edging?

Yes, there are several safety considerations to take into account when installing and using steel and aluminum edging. One of the primary concerns is the risk of injury from sharp edges or points, particularly with steel edging. To minimize this risk, it is essential to wear protective clothing, including gloves and safety glasses, when handling and installing edging materials. Additionally, homeowners and landscape designers should ensure that the edging is securely anchored and stable to prevent it from shifting or toppling over, which could cause injury or damage.

Another safety consideration is the potential for tripping or slipping hazards, particularly in areas with heavy foot traffic or uneven terrain. To minimize this risk, it is essential to ensure that the edging is flush with the surrounding surface and that there are no sharp edges or protrusions that could cause tripping or slipping. Additionally, homeowners and landscape designers can consider using edging materials with textured or slip-resistant surfaces to improve traction and safety. By taking these precautions, it is possible to enjoy the benefits of steel and aluminum edging while minimizing the risk of injury or accident.
